TITLE:
Centennial Discovery Insecure File Permissions

SECUNIA ADVISORY ID:
SA25354

VERIFY ADVISORY:
http://secunia.com/advisories/25354/

CRITICAL:
Less critical

IMPACT:
Manipulation of data, Privilege escalation

WHERE:
Local system

SOFTWARE:
Centennial Discovery 2006 6.x
http://secunia.com/product/13580/

DESCRIPTION:
Secunia Research has discovered a security issue in Centennial
Discovery, which can be exploited by malicious, local users to gain
escalated privileges.

The problem is caused due to insecure default file permissions being
set on the "Discovery" directory. This can be exploited to gain
escalated privileges by placing malicious files or replacing e.g
certain DLL files in the directory.

The security issue is confirmed in Centennial Discovery 2006 Feature
Pack 1. Other versions may also be affected.

SOLUTION:
Reportedly, the vendor is working on a fix.

Grant only trusted users access to affected systems until a fix is
available.

PROVIDED AND/OR DISCOVERED BY:
Sven Krewitt, Secunia Research.
